The City of Sherbrooke is seeking proposals for the acquisition and implementation of a debt and treasury management system. The contract involves procuring a scalable and modern solution that supports a range of functionalities and ensures ongoing technological and functional evolution. The project includes not only the purchase of the system but also professional services necessary for its integration, data conversion, training, and ongoing support throughout the contract duration. Implementation for the debt management component is expected to take about ten months, while the treasury management portion is projected to require six to eight months. Following the implementation phase and warranty period, a five-year support contract will be in place with an option to extend for an additional five years. Submissions will be evaluated using a two-stage process prioritizing quality and price. Only bids scoring at least 70 out of 100 during the qualitative assessment will proceed to the price evaluation phase. Bidders must submit two separate envelopes containing the technical offer and the pricing details. The full solicitation is managed by the Government of Canada and responds to procurement needs in the Estrie region, with the contract potentially spanning up to ten years.
